What to know about Kyoto National Museum

Discover the captivating allure of the Kyoto National Museum, a treasure trove of art and history nestled in the heart of Kyoto's historic Higashiyama district. Established in 1897, this esteemed institution offers a unique glimpse into Japan's rich cultural heritage, making it a must-visit destination for art enthusiasts and history buffs alike. The museum showcases an impressive collection of pre-modern Japanese and Asian art, offering a fascinating journey through centuries of artistic heritage. Whether you're an art lover or a history aficionado, the Kyoto National Museum promises an enriching experience that delves deep into the captivating world of Japan's past.

Cultural and Historical Significance

The Kyoto National Museum stands as a beacon of Japanese culture and history, offering visitors a captivating journey through the country's artistic evolution. Originally established as the Imperial Museum of Kyoto, it has transformed into a national treasure, dedicated to preserving and showcasing art treasures from temples, shrines, and the Imperial Household. This reflects Japan's unwavering commitment to cultural preservation and provides a vital link to understanding the nation's past and artistic legacy.

Diverse Collections

The museum's diverse collections are a testament to Japan's rich artistic heritage, divided into Fine Arts, Handicrafts, and Archaeology. Visitors can marvel at Heian period artifacts, rare sutras, and ancient Chinese and Japanese scrolls, offering a comprehensive view of the country's artistic evolution. Each piece tells a story, inviting you to explore the intricate tapestry of Japan's cultural history.
